Kruzel to return as Chiefs manager in 2015

The St. Louis Cardinals announced today that Joe Kruzel will return as manager of the Peoria Chiefs in 2015. It will be his second season as Chiefs skipper.

Kruzel led the Chiefs to a 72-67 record in 2014. The team missed a playoff berth by one game in both halves of the season.

Before managing the Chiefs, Kruzel spent time in the Midwest League as hitting coach of the Quad Cities River Bandits, from 2008 to 2012. The River Bandits were affiliated with the Cardinals during Kruzel’s time with the team.

Jobel Jimenez will return for his second season as hitting coach of the Chiefs. Newcomer Dernier Orozco will be Peoria’s pitching coach after two seasons serving in the same capacity for the State College Spikes, the Cardinals’ affiliate in the short-season New York-Penn League.

Side note: Seeing Dernier Orozco’s name made me think of former major-leaguers Bob Dernier and Jesse Orosco. Both men have a past with the Peoria Chiefs. Dernier worked with Chiefs players as the Chicago Cubs’ roving minor-league coach for baserunning and outfielders from 2007 to 2010. Orosco made two rehab appearances with the Chiefs in 2000, pitching 1.2 scoreless innings.
